Douglas MacArthur quotes


In war, when a commander becomes so bereft of reason and perspective that he fails to understand the dependence of arms on Divine guidance, he no longer deserves victory.

 

There is no security on this earth; there is only opportunity.

 

In war there is no substitute for victory.

 

There is no substitute for victory.

 

Age wrinkles the body. Quitting wrinkles the soul.

 

Duty, Honor, Country. Those three hallowed words reverently dictate what you ought to be, what you can be, what you will be.

 

A better world shall emerge based on faith and understanding.
